The M5Stack Cardputer: A Closer Look
What Is the Cardputer?
The M5Stack Cardputer is a card-sized portable computer designed for engineers and tinkerers. At its core lies the M5StampS3, a mini development board based on the ESP32-S3 chip. Let's dive into its features:
1. Powerful Dual-Core Processor: The M5StampS3 boasts a dual-core processor, making it ideal for rapid functional verification, industrial control, and home automation systems.
2. Integrated Peripherals and Sensors:
- 56-Key Keyboard: Easily enter information.
- 1.14-Inch TFT Screen: View data and feedback.
- SPM1423 Digital MEMS Microphone: Enables voice operations like recording and wake-up.
- Built-in Speaker: For audio playback.
- Infrared Emitter: Allows infrared control interaction with external devices (TVs, air conditioners, etc.).
- HY2.0-4P Port: Expandable for connecting I2C sensors (temperature, humidity, light, pressure, etc.).
- Micro SD Card Slot: Expand storage space for program code, data files, images, and audio.
3. Battery-Powered Freedom:
- Internal 120mAh + 1400mAh lithium battery (in the base) ensures long battery life.
- Built-in battery charging and voltage regulation circuits protect the battery and the device.
4. Magnetized Base and Lego Compatibility:
- Attach the Cardputer to metal surfaces (fridges, whiteboards) using the base magnet.
- Compatible with Lego hole extensions for creative designs.
Getting Started
1. Programming Options:
- Arduino IDE: Control the Cardputer through Arduino IDE programming.
- UIFlow 2.0: Use the UIFlow 2.0 graphical programming platform for an intuitive experience.
2. Applications:
- Fast functional verification and prototyping
- Industrial control and automation
- Home control systems
- Data acquisition and sensor monitoring
- Embedded system development and learning
- Wireless communication and IoT projects
